People with autism spectrum disorder have a tendency to be aloof, so that they keep a distance from others that feels emotionall

y manageable to them. Others, in turn, are likely to maintain that interpersonal distance. In this case, aloofness is a(n) _____ trait.

Answer:

evocative trait

Explanation:

Evocative traits explain inherited attributes that produce certain responses from the environment or in this case affect the behavior of other people towards a person. These behaviors may strengthen the child's initial attributes.

Example:

good athletes get more attention and get better when the average players don't get better because the good players are getting all the attention.

Chanel is a six-month-old baby. Her mother shows her a teddy bear and she giggles. However, when her mother hides the teddy bear
Ivahew [28]

Answer:

object permanence    

Explanation:

Jean Piaget was a famous psychologist who has given the theory of cognitive development in which he has mentioned four distinct stages including the sensorimotor, preoperational, concrete operational, and formal operational stage.

Object permanence: According to Piaget's theory, the term object permanence occurs during the first stage of cognitive development i.e, the sensorimotor stage. It develops around four to seven months of a child's life.

Object permanence states that a particular object still exists even when it can't be perceived i.e, touched, sensed, seen, heard, smelled, etc.

In the question above, Chanel has not yet developed object permanence.
